Name John Romilus Haynes Birth 4 Apr 1786 Northumberland Co., Pennsylvania, USA Gender Male Death 31 Aug 1856 Lawrence, Van Buren Co., Michigan, USA Burial Lawrence, Van Buren Co., Michigan, USA Notes - Built a house in 1815 in Geneseo, in 1917 it was occupied by Jefferson Wynn. John later moved to Michigan where he was one of the first settlers of Lawrence,MI and prominent in the development of the community, he was also Judge of Van Buren and Kalamazoo Counties.
